Bluetooth SIG adopts core version 2.1 +EDR -... →
better pairing(not there’s anything wrong with the current, don’t get the “not a few fiddly minutes” from Sean Cooper)
possible NFC, automatic pairing based on very close proximity
security improvements
better power management, up to 5 times
Acer installing Linux on notebooks, but not Ubuntu... →
Update on this, it seems that Acer is indeed offering preinstalled linux on some Aspire models, but not in the Ubuntu flavour, reseller Memory World was responsible for the deed, but only a few 50 were sold. D-Nexus, another Singaporean reseller, is offering Acer notebooks pre installed with Linpus, a Taiwanese distro.
